5. Emphasis of Matterl
We draw attention to the following matters in the notes to the statement:
a. Note No. 3, regarding provision towards Service Tax I GST liability on royalty on
Crude Oil and Natural Gas, under the Oil Fields (Regulation & Development) Act,
1948 provided for the quafter ending 30th June, 2026 is 289.56 crore which
includes an interest of L L03.77 crore. As on 30th June, 2026 the Company's total
provision towards Service Tax & GST on Royalty is 5,043.33 crore (Assam,
Arunachal Pradesh and Rajasthan) which includes interest of 996.25 crore. Out
of this provision, the Company has already deposited an amount of T L,499.62
crore (including interest of 11.18 crore) towards Service Tax & GST on Royalty
under protest.
In a recent development, the Hon'ble Supreme Cour[ having taken note of the
submission made on behalf of the Company by the learned Solicitor General of
India to deposit the GST as per law within a period of six weeks, subject to final
outcome of the pending proceedings. The Hon'ble Supreme court thereafter
tagged the Transfer Petition (C) 300-30412024, with C.A. No. 10560/2025 (Udaipur
Chamber of Commerce and Industry vs. Union of India) vide its order dated
29.07.2026. The payment shall however be made under protest subject to the final
outcome of the pending proceedings. In respect of future liabilities, the same shall
also be deposited under protest as and when accrued.
b. Note No. 4, regarding the demand of t 2,484.8I crore raised by the Government
of Assam under Assam Taxation (on Specified Lands) Act, 1990 ("the Principal
Act") vide the Assam Taxation (on Specified Lands) (Amendment) Act, 2004, for
the calendar years 2005-2024 under the Amendment Act, which has been
challenged by the Company and disclosed as contingent liability, The case was
pending before the Hon'ble Supreme Court
